What this grant of permission means

Camden granted permission on 12 July 2013, subject to any conditions on the decision notice. Work must normally begin within three years or the permission lapses. More in our guide to what happens after a planning decision.

About heritage and listed building applications

Listed building consent is needed for works that affect the special interest of a listed building, and carrying out such works without it is a criminal offence. More in our guide to planning application types.
